Readability Considerations for Different Formats
While Butterfly Floral Monogram is visually stunning, it’s important to consider its readability across different platforms and formats. For screen reading, ensure that the font size is large enough to accommodate the intricate details without compromising legibility.
When exporting to PDF or printing, test the font at various sizes to ensure it maintains clarity. In mobile layouts, avoid using it for long blocks of text, as it may become difficult to read. Instead, reserve it for headlines, captions, and accents where its decorative nature shines.
Font Pairing for Editorial Success
Pairing Butterfly Floral Monogram with complementary fonts can enhance its effectiveness in editorial design. For instance, pairing it with a classic serif font like Garamond or Baskerville creates a refined look suitable for luxury brands or literary publications.
If you’re aiming for a more modern feel, consider combining it with a clean sans-serif font such as Helvetica or Roboto for body copy. This combination allows the display font to take center stage while ensuring the rest of the content remains easy to read.
For social media graphics or web design, pair it with a simple, readable font for navigation menus and captions. This approach ensures that the Butterfly Floral Monogram remains a standout element without overshadowing other design components.
